Finally made it out today after several years of working too much to be able to salmon fish seriously. Took a retired friend who had never been salmon fishing. Main purpose was to familiarize him with trolling and the equipment and to knock the dust off of my riggers and lures that haven't been wet in a long time. We didn't get out until about 10 am and fished till 4:30 or so. Straight out of the harbor to 50 -60 fow, then east around the barge into 25 fow. Had one release, felt small and shook the hook pretty quickly. Fish hit a DW Magnum Lemon Ice which the last time I caught a chinook was the hot bait...lol. That might tell ya the last time I trolled on the big lake. Tried several different spoons, plugs etc along with different depths and speeds. No other strikes. I did speak with a fella as I was heading in that said he had put 3 in the boat in 2 hours fishing north out of the harbor in 30-40 fow. So, for the first trip in several years and with a new partner, everything thing shook out okay. Was hoping to get this guy his first king but alas, there's a reason it's called fishing and not catching I guess. I'm gonna watch the weather the next couple of days and we're planning on heading back out early Friday morning. Not the report I was hoping to give but it is an honest one. Tight lines guys.
